Uncharismatic Fact of the Day
The skunk’s defense system is infamous for its unpleasantness. However, stink it’s the only danger they pose. Not only is their spray notoriously foul, it’s highly flammable. Skunk anal glands produce a sulfur-based oil made of thiol compounds, which are also found in foods like garlic and onions.

Mephitidae
The Mephitidae is a mammal family which is made up of skunks and stink badgers. They are known for their anal scent glands used for deterring predators.
